Snegurochka is a small, frozen, hostile planet light years from Earth. The research/mining facility on the planet’s surface has been plagued by strange occurrences and mysterious deaths. The prevailing rumour is that it’s haunted. For most of the staff, it’s just a rumour — until now.

All contact with the facility is lost.

Corporal Matt Sloane and his elite special ops unit is sent to investigate. Complicating matters, they’re saddled with a group of scientists. Among them is brilliant astrobiologist Dr. Kate Fairchild, Matt’s ex-girlfriend.

Once in the facility, Matt, Kate, and the others find it deserted, the staff butchered. But soon they are confronted by the same enemy that killed the facility’s staff — an enemy unlike anything they’ve ever faced, capable of bringing their greatest fears and nightmares to life. Matt must do battle with this threat, face his inner demons, the traumatic memories of a past mission gone wrong, and get his people out alive.
